Scala – Print EVEN Number from an Array

Here, we will create an array of integer elements, and then we will find the EVEN numbers.

Scala code to find the EVEN numbers from the array

The source code to find the EVEN numbers from the array is given below. The given program is compiled and executed on the ubuntu 18.04 operating system successfully.

// Scala program to find the EVEN numbers 
// from the array

object Sample {  
    def main(args: Array[String]) {  
        var IntArray = Array(10,11,12,13,14,15)
        var count:Int=0
        
        println("Even numbers are: ")
        while(count<IntArray.size)
        {
            if (IntArray(count)%2==0) 
            {
                printf("%d ",IntArray(count));
            }
            count=count+1
        }
        
        println()
    }
} 

Output

Even numbers are: 
10 12 14

Explanation

In the above program, we used an object-oriented approach to create the program. We created an object Sample, and we defined main() function. The main() function is the entry point for the program.

In the main() function, we created an array IntArray and also created one more integer variable count. Then we found the EVEN numbers and printed them on the console screen.
